Board of trade barbecue

-

The Greater Westside Board of Trade held a member-appreciati­on barbecue Tuesday at its office parking lot on Dobbin Road in West Kelowna. Burgers, hotdogs and refreshmen­ts were provided to all members under the shade of tents over tables. Daily Courier photograph­er Gary Nylander dropped by the event and took these photos. The board’s next event is Business After Hours at noon July 13 at Manchester Signs, Printing and Graphics, 5-1718 Byland Rd.
